DescriptionEmbeddable relational database for web apps written in pure JavaScriptEmbeddable persistent key-value store optimized for fast storage (flash and RAM)SpaceTime is a spatio-temporal DBMS with a focus on performance.
Primary database modelRelational DBMSKey-value storeSpatial DBMS
